Exactly one century after the tragic death of architect Antoni Gaudí, Pope Leo XIV is in Barcelona today to inaugurate the tallest tower of the Sagrada Família, the church envisioned by the brilliant Catalan architect.
During today’s service, the Pope will bless the Tower of Jesus Christ, which was completed last February.
Present in Barcelona are Spain’s King Felipe and his wife, Queen Letizia, along with guests from around the world.
Standing approximately 172 meters tall, the tower has made the Sagrada Família the tallest Christian church in the world. At its summit stands a gigantic ceramic cross, which has now become the monument’s most recognizable new feature.
